Understanding Zeevracht Tarieven

Zeevracht tarieven, or sea freight rates, refer to the costs associated with transporting goods via ocean carriers. These rates are typically calculated based on the following factors:

  • Container size and type
  • Shipping route
  • Fuel surcharges
  • Peak season adjustments
  • Port fees and handling charges

It’s important to note that zeevracht tarieven can vary significantly depending on whether you’re shipping a full container load (FCL) or a less than container load (LCL). Let’s explore these options in more detail.

Full Container Load (FCL) Shipping

FCL shipping involves booking an entire container for your goods. This option is ideal for larger shipments or when you want to ensure your cargo doesn’t share space with other shippers’ goods. FCL rates are typically more cost-effective for larger volumes and offer greater security and faster transit times.

Less than Container Load (LCL) Shipping

LCL shipping allows you to ship smaller quantities of goods by sharing container space with other shippers. While this option may have a higher per-unit cost, it’s more economical for smaller shipments and provides greater flexibility in terms of shipping frequency.



Factors Influencing Zeevracht Tarieven

Several key factors can impact sea freight rates. Understanding these can help you better predict and plan for shipping costs:

1. Fuel Prices

Bunker fuel prices significantly influence sea freight rates. As fuel costs rise, shipping lines often implement fuel surcharges to offset these expenses.

2. Supply and Demand

The balance between available shipping capacity and cargo volume plays a crucial role in determining rates. During peak seasons or when demand outstrips supply, rates tend to increase.

3. Route Popularity

Popular shipping routes often have more competitive rates due to higher vessel frequency and capacity. Less frequented routes may have higher rates due to limited options.

4. Geopolitical Factors

Trade tensions, sanctions, or regional conflicts can impact shipping routes and, consequently, freight rates.

5. Currency Fluctuations

As international trade often involves multiple currencies, exchange rate fluctuations can affect the final cost of shipping.



Optimizing Your Shipping Strategy

Now that we’ve covered the basics of zeevracht tarieven, let’s explore some strategies to optimize your shipping approach:

1. Plan Ahead

Booking your shipments well in advance can often secure better rates and ensure container availability, especially during peak seasons.

2. Consider Consolidation

If you regularly ship smaller quantities, consider consolidating shipments to take advantage of FCL rates. This can lead to significant cost savings over time.

3. Explore Different Routes

Sometimes, alternative routes or transshipment options can offer more competitive rates. Working with a knowledgeable freight forwarder can help identify these opportunities.

4. Negotiate Long-term Contracts

For businesses with consistent shipping needs, negotiating long-term contracts with carriers can provide more stable rates and priority space allocation.

5. Stay Informed

Keep abreast of market trends, geopolitical developments, and industry news that might impact freight rates. This knowledge can help you make informed decisions about when and how to ship.

The Future of Zeevracht Tarieven

As we look to the future, several trends are likely to shape the landscape of sea freight rates:

1. Sustainability Initiatives

As the shipping industry moves towards more sustainable practices, we may see the introduction of “green” surcharges or incentives for eco-friendly shipping options.

3. Digitalization

The ongoing digital transformation of the shipping industry is likely to lead to more efficient operations and potentially more stable and predictable freight rates.

4. New Trade Routes

The development of new trade routes, such as those opened up by climate change in the Arctic, could significantly impact global shipping patterns and rates.

5. Regulatory Changes

New international regulations, particularly those related to emissions and safety, could impact operational costs and, consequently, freight rates.
